Has Hadith Text | Abu Huraira reported Allah Messenger ﷺ as … Abu Huraira reported Allah Messenger ﷺ as sayings: A person suffered from intense thirst while on a journey; when he found a well. He climbed down into it and drank water and then came out and saw a dog lolling its tongue on account of thirst and eating the moistened earth. The person said: This dog has suffered from thirst as I had suffered from it. He climbed down into the well; filled his shoe with water; then caught it in his mouth until he climbed up and made the dog drink it. So Allah appreciated this act of his and pardoned him. Then the Companions around him said: Allah Messenger; is there for us a reward even for serving such animals? He said: Yes; there is a reward for service to every living animal. reward for service to every living animal. + |
